LANDFORMS *Almost all of Antarctica’s land is covered by hundreds of metres os snow built up over millions of years. *Antarctica has no forests, woods, grasslands or sandy beaches. *The Transantarctic Mountains forms an almost unbroken chain separating Antarctica into east (being larger) and west.
